>At 2:24 AM -0400 2005-07-07, Vinny Abello wrote:
>
> > It doesn't matter how you setup the record pointing to the web
> > server.
>
> Actually, it does matter. The name has to resolve directly to
>the IP address. If you use a CNAME record instead, most browsers and
>proxies will change the name that is being asked for to match the
>"canonical name" that they've been given. If you give them an IP
>address instead, they go ahead and use the original name as provided.
